HPCC President Virbhadra Singh lost his cool and abused the media persons on Wednesday when he was questioned on the corruption allegations against him. He threatened to break the cameras of media persons.

Singh lost his cool when media persons asked his clarification over the alleged corruption allegations leveled by BJP leaders particularly Arun Jaitley. Earlier Senior BJP leader Arun Jaitley had alleged that Singh had altered his income tax account books from 2008 onwards to show a forged, back-dated contract and a highly inflated income of around Rs 6.5 crore.

However, the Congress apologised to mediapersons. In a statement party spokesperson Sandeep Dikshit apologized on the behalf of party. Terming as “unfortunate” Singh’s remarks, the party said such things can sometime happen in the midst of an election campaign.
